OverviewRush Street Interactive (NYSE: RSI) is a market leader in online casino and sports betting, currently operating real‐money gaming with our brands: BetRivers.Com, PlaySugarHouse.Com, and RushBet.Co. We're building bridges between online, social and land‐based gaming businesses to create amazing, integrated experiences that keep players in the game.About the RoleWe are a mobile‐first organization evolving our digital platform toward a modern, scalable, event‐driven architecture. As a Sr. Front End Engineer, you will play a foundational role in building and evolving our client applications and event orchestration architecture that powers them.This role extends beyond traditional feature development. You will help architect and implement scalable client‐side instrumentation frameworks, shared frontend capabilities, and integration patterns that enable structured event collection, analytics, lifecycle engagement, and downstream data systems.You will work in close coordination with feature delivery teams to ensure instrumentation and orchestration standards are embedded directly into product development. In parallel, you will shape the long‐term evolution of our client event architecture.What You'll DoClient & Mobile EngineeringFrontend development across web and native mobile platforms (React, Angular, TypeScript, iOS, Android).Contribute to and evolve a modular, scalable micro‐frontend architecture.Build reusable frontend components and shared client frameworks.Optimize performance and responsiveness across devices, with particular focus on mobile reliability and efficiency.Establish best practices for SDK integrations, consent enforcement, observability, and client performance.Event Instrumentation & OrchestrationDesign and implement structured event instrumentation frameworks across web and mobile applications.Instrument native iOS and Android applications, including analytics/CDP SDK integration with attention to performance, batching, offline handling,
and reliability.Define, version, and govern structured event schemas and taxonomy standards.Architect scalable integration patterns between client applications, backend services, and downstream data platforms.Ensure event data is reliable, well‐structured, and suitable for streaming, analytics, identity resolution, and activation use cases.Support monitoring, debugging, and continuous improvement of client event pipelines.Cross‐FunctionalPartner closely with Product, Analytics, and Engineering teams to align instrumentation and architecture with business objectives.Participate in architectural discussions that shape long‐term platform modernization.Balance ongoing support needs with forward‐looking architectural improvements.Mentor engineers, conduct code reviews, and elevate frontend and mobile engineering standards.Clearly communicate technical concepts to both technical and non‐technical stakeholders.What You'll Bring8+ years of experience in software engineering with strong frontend expertise.Deep experience building and scaling web and native mobile applications.Strong proficiency in React, Angular, TypeScript, and native iOS/Android development.Proven experience implementing analytics or CDP SDKs within mobile applications.Strong understanding of event‐driven architecture and structured event schema design.Experience integrating client event streams into CDPs and downstream analytics platforms.Familiarity with relational databases (Postgres, Oracle) and analytical platforms (e.G., Snowflake).Experience with CI/CD pipelines, Git‐based workflows,
